## Tidewatch Widget — Plugin Onboarding

Tidewatch renders tide tables for coastal dashboards. Plugins call the Moonpool prediction API; responses are cached 6h. Required fields: station slug, date range (max 14 days), units. Rate limit: 120 req/min per plugin. Do not scrape the web UI; it will be blocked. Errors return standard envelope with retryable flag. Test against the staging harbor dataset before requesting production scopes. For staging access, authenticate every request with the key below.

API key for yahig-tadup: kto7_ubizbYm

Runbook: GarageGlance occupancy feed

If the Harborview Deck occupancy feed goes stale (no updates for 5+ minutes), first check the sensor gateway health page. Green but stale usually means the aggregator queue is backed up; restart the aggregator via the ops console and counts should recover within two minutes. If spots show negative numbers, force a full recount from the camera snapshots. When escalating to engineering, include the trace token shown below.

session token of yawif-kahof = htk9_dd6996ed6

TURN-208: Gatevale turnstile counters at the Merrow Field pilot double-count when a rotation reverses mid-cycle. Attendance totals drift roughly 2% high per event. The debounce window fix is implemented, reviewed by Ilsa, and soak-tested across two simulated match days without drift. Ready for your cut; the candidate build is identified below.

trace token, tagag-tafog: htk6_5ed18c

Partner SFTP drop for Brindlecore stalled again overnight. Files land in the inbound folder but the pickup job never fires; queue shows zero events. Likely the watcher restarted without re-registering the path. Support: tell partners uploads are safe, just delayed. Retry scheduled hourly until Ops confirms. When escalating, quote the trace token below so backend can find the run.

session token of yahof-bajeg = htk9_0d43d44ed